Power disruptions choke Mimosa

Mimosa continued to experience sporadic regional power disruptions

MIMOSA Mining Company (Mimosa)’s production slipped during the third quarter ended March 31, 2026, as intermittent power outages and challenging geological conditions weighed on operations. The platinum miner was not spared from nationwide electricity disruptions during the period which slowed operating momentum and affected processing stability.
